WebWe offer cytologic evaluation of multiple fluid types, including body cavity fluids, cerebrospinal fluid, synovial fluid and tracheal and bronchoalveolar washes. Fluids from cystic masses and other sites (urine, bile) may also be submitted. Slide-only cytology samples (eg. FNAs from lymph nodes, solid masses and internal organs) are not accepted. WebThe entire head of the brush/broom is removed from the handle and placed into a SurePath collection vial. The brush/broom must remain in the vial. Record the patient name and ID number on the vial. The sample will be returned if it is received without proper labeling.
